To be honest , any coin run by ASICS will be centralized due to economic's forces.
(Only the Rich can afford the costs of maintaining ASICS.)

All PoW coins will eventually uses ASICS or be centralized to mining farms, it is a design flaw in PoW that can not be fixed.
You have to move to a new algo to stop centralization, if that is your main concern.


True. That's why there should be a POS Bitcoin. That one will be the winner. Moreover, it will not use as much energy as the POW Bitcoin which is better for the environment. If I would be working on Blockchains than I would have made a Bitcoin POS split.

"Seven teams of developers came together in London, to talk about the future of Bitcoin Cash; Bitcoin ABC, Bitcrust, Bitprim, Bitcoin Unlimited, ElectrumX, nChain, and Parity. This appears to be more than it really is, the teams are very small, but it illustrates aspiration of Bitcoin Cash to be a project of different teams."- http://www.allcryptocurrencies.news/bitcoin-cash/bitcoin-cash-abc-and-bu-announce-roadmap-for-2018/
